What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.651(i)(3): Sidewalks, pavements and appurtenant structure shall not be undermined unless a support system or another method of protection is provided to protect employees from the possible collapse of such structures.out    On or about August 22,2012 at the above addressed jobsite, employees were installing a sewer line in a trench below pavement which was undercut, thereby exposing the employees to cave in hazards. 29 CFR 1926.652(a)(1):  Each employee in an excavation shall be protected from cave-ins by an adequate protective system designed in accordance with paragraph (b) or (c) of this section:    On or about August 22, 2012, at the above addressed jobsite, employees were installing a sewer line in a trench measured at ten (10) feet five (5) inches in depth.  The trench was not provided with adequate cave in protection, thereby exposing the employees to the hazards associated with cave ins. 29 CFR 1926.652(g)(1)(ii): Shields shall be installed in a manner to restrict lateral or other hazardous movement of the shield in the event of the application of sudden lateral loads.    On or about August 22, 2012, at the above addressed jobsite, employees were installing a sewer line in a trench measured at ten (10) feet five (5) inches in depth.  The trench shield was  not installed to prevent lateral movement, thereby exposing the employees to the hazards associated with cave ins.
